package org.aavso.tools.vstar.data.validation;

/**
 * This abstract base class represents a predicate involving a numeric range.
 */
public abstract class RangePredicate {

	protected final double lower;
	protected final double upper;
	
	/**
	 * Constructor.
	 * 
	 * @param lower The lower bound of the range.
	 * @param upper The upper bound of the range.
	 */
	public RangePredicate(double lower, double upper) {
		this.lower = lower;
		this.upper = upper;
	}
	
	/**
	 * Does the predicate hold true?
	 * 
	 * @param value The value to which to apply the predicate.
	 * @return True or False.
	 */
	public abstract boolean holds(double value);
}
